OmniPlan 2.2 is actually not in the App Store queue anymore, it was rejected because of some unsupported API use that accidentally slipped in when we were adding support for Retina displays. Sorry about that!

We'll be submitting OmniPlan 2.2.1 to the App Store as soon as it's ready to go. (If you're impatient and brave, you can download unstable sneaky peek builds from our website.)

I should note that it took four weeks for OmniGraffle 5.4.2 to make it through the App Store review process, so it may also take a while for OmniPlan 2.2.1 to be approved once it actually is submitted. (It sounds like Apple has their hands full trying to review all of everyone's app updates for Sandboxing, Retina, Mountain Lion, and iOS 6.)
